Use the Network Tools to troubleshoot BYOC Premises Edge connectivity
Prerequisites
- Telephony > Plugin > All permission
If you have an BYOC Premises Edge that is running Linux, then you can use the four network commands to troubleshoot connectivity to the Edge.
| Command | Description |
|---|---|
| nslookup | Query a DNS domain nameserver to lookup and find IP address information. |
| ping | Test the reachability of a host on your network. |
| route | View the IP routing table. |
| tracepath | Trace path to the destination and report the Maximum Transmission Unit (MTU) along the path. |
- Click Admin.
- Under Telephony, click Edges.
- Click Menu > Digital and Telephony > Telephony > Edges.
- From the Edge Name column, click the name of the Edge you want.
- Click the Diagnostics tab.
- Click Network Tools.
- From the Command list, select one of the available network tools.
- In the Host box, type hostname or IP address.
- Click Run.
The output from the command will appear in the Results box.
